Commit Graph

427 Commits

Author SHA1 Message Date
leeheejin e0143e9cba 문서뷰어기능구현 2025-09-29 13:29:03 +09:00
leeheejin 3600621554 화면관리 쪽 파일첨부 수정 2025-09-26 17:12:03 +09:00
leeheejin 1fe401c7d6 Merge branch 'main' of http://39.117.244.52:3000/kjs/ERP-node into lhj 2025-09-26 13:11:44 +09:00
leeheejin ee7c8e989e 파일 업로드 기능 구현 및 상세설정 연동
- 템플릿 파일첨부 컴포넌트와 FileComponentConfigPanel 실시간 동기화
- FileUpload 위젯에 전역 파일 상태 관리 기능 추가
- 파일 업로드/삭제 시 전역 상태 및 localStorage 동기화
- RealtimePreview에서 전역 상태 우선 읽기 및 파일 개수 표시
- 한컴오피스, Apple iWork 파일 형식 지원 추가
- 파일 뷰어 모달 및 미리보기 기능 구현
- 업로드된 파일 디렉토리 .gitignore 추가
2025-09-26 13:11:34 +09:00
hjlee ddd191b87b Merge pull request 'dev' (#65) from dev into main
Reviewed-on: http://39.117.244.52:3000/kjs/ERP-node/pulls/65
2025-09-25 18:57:35 +09:00
hjlee 74fdaea4ac Merge pull request 'lhj' (#64) from lhj into dev
Reviewed-on: http://39.117.244.52:3000/kjs/ERP-node/pulls/64
2025-09-25 18:56:44 +09:00
leeheejin c28e27f3e8 화면관리의 테이블 리스트, 카드 디스플레이 수정 2025-09-25 18:54:25 +09:00
leeheejin d69feef9da 화면관리의 테이블 리스트, 카드 디스플레이 수정 2025-09-25 18:54:12 +09:00
hjlee a06f41dbdb Merge pull request 'dev' (#63) from dev into main
Reviewed-on: http://39.117.244.52:3000/kjs/ERP-node/pulls/63
2025-09-25 16:23:18 +09:00
hjlee ecac852d7a Merge pull request '콘솔 주석처리, 화면관리쪽 컬럼수, 페이지네이션 수정' (#62) from lhj into dev
Reviewed-on: http://39.117.244.52:3000/kjs/ERP-node/pulls/62
2025-09-25 16:22:40 +09:00
leeheejin 28485d6e5c 콘솔 주석처리, 화면관리쪽 컬럼수, 페이지네이션 수정 2025-09-25 16:22:02 +09:00
hjlee c0414abaa0 Merge pull request 'dev' (#61) from dev into main
Reviewed-on: http://39.117.244.52:3000/kjs/ERP-node/pulls/61
2025-09-25 14:32:43 +09:00
hjlee 1977e73c80 Merge pull request 'lhj' (#60) from lhj into dev
Reviewed-on: http://39.117.244.52:3000/kjs/ERP-node/pulls/60
2025-09-25 14:31:58 +09:00
leeheejin cd84d9033c uiux 개선 2025-09-25 14:22:30 +09:00
kjs 0d46bc540c 타입스크립트 에러수정 2025-09-25 10:13:43 +09:00
kjs 7b84102cd9 도커설정 2025-09-25 09:53:23 +09:00
kjs 25ecfa13d2 Merge branch 'main' of http://39.117.244.52:3000/kjs/ERP-node 2025-09-25 09:37:25 +09:00
kjs d7ac8113ba 도커설정 2025-09-25 09:37:24 +09:00
kjs acfe282dae Merge pull request 'feature/screen-management' (#59) from feature/screen-management into main
Reviewed-on: http://39.117.244.52:3000/kjs/ERP-node/pulls/59
2025-09-25 09:32:39 +09:00
kjs 623a76080a Merge branch 'main' of http://39.117.244.52:3000/kjs/ERP-node into feature/screen-management 2025-09-25 09:32:11 +09:00
hjlee cb0058cd37 Merge pull request 'dev' (#58) from dev into main
Reviewed-on: http://39.117.244.52:3000/kjs/ERP-node/pulls/58
2025-09-25 09:31:48 +09:00
kjs 026e79688a 도커설정 2025-09-25 09:31:44 +09:00
hjlee 93a11fdbf3 Merge pull request 'lhj' (#57) from lhj into dev
Reviewed-on: http://39.117.244.52:3000/kjs/ERP-node/pulls/57
2025-09-25 09:30:59 +09:00
leeheejin e3cd6dc3a0 UI/UX 개선: 사이드바 레이아웃 안정화 및 메뉴 hover 효과 개선
- 사이드바 고정 너비 설정으로 메뉴 클릭 시 너비 변화 방지
- 메뉴 항목 hover 효과 일관성 개선 (고정 높이, 부드러운 색상 전환)
- 디버깅 로그 제거로 성능 최적화
- 관리자 페이지 카드 디자인 개선 (그라데이션 배경, 아이콘 색상 조정)
2025-09-25 09:29:56 +09:00
kjs b41e645c74 제어관리 외부 커넥션 설정기능 2025-09-24 18:23:57 +09:00
leeheejin 1a60177fe4 feat: 관리자 페이지 레이아웃 통일 및 JSX 구문 수정
- admin/screenMng, dataflow 페이지에 tableMng 레퍼런스 레이아웃 적용
- admin/standards 페이지 JSX 괄호 문제 수정
- 전체 관리자 페이지 UI 일관성 향상
- bg-gray-50 배경, container 구조, 통일된 제목 스타일 적용
2025-09-24 18:07:36 +09:00
kjs 3c839a56bf Merge pull request 'feature/screen-management' (#56) from feature/screen-management into main
Reviewed-on: http://39.117.244.52:3000/kjs/ERP-node/pulls/56
2025-09-24 15:03:15 +09:00
kjs 0d9ee4c40f 테이블 컬럼 표시문제 수정 2025-09-24 15:02:54 +09:00
kjs 649ed5c6d7 조인컬럼수정(조인 컬럼 추가시 엔티티 타입 표시 오류) 2025-09-24 14:31:46 +09:00
kjs 86dc961968 조인컬럼 오류 2025-09-24 12:56:22 +09:00
kjs d52d6c129b Merge pull request 'feature/screen-management' (#55) from feature/screen-management into main
Reviewed-on: http://39.117.244.52:3000/kjs/ERP-node/pulls/55
2025-09-24 10:50:18 +09:00
kjs d5b63d1c9b Merge branch 'main' into feature/screen-management 2025-09-24 10:50:09 +09:00
kjs e75889a127 조인 컬럼 문제 수정 2025-09-24 10:33:54 +09:00
hjlee 4b148ee823 Merge pull request 'dev' (#54) from dev into main
Reviewed-on: http://39.117.244.52:3000/kjs/ERP-node/pulls/54
2025-09-24 10:31:51 +09:00
hjlee bb642cab04 Merge pull request '데이터베이스 틀린 비밀번호 입력시 연결거부처리' (#53) from lhj into dev
Reviewed-on: http://39.117.244.52:3000/kjs/ERP-node/pulls/53
2025-09-24 10:31:28 +09:00
leeheejin 4efec8d758 데이터베이스 틀린 비밀번호 입력시 연결거부처리 2025-09-24 10:30:36 +09:00
hjlee db08d9e6b9 Merge pull request 'dev' (#52) from dev into main
Reviewed-on: http://39.117.244.52:3000/kjs/ERP-node/pulls/52
2025-09-24 10:06:35 +09:00
hjlee 192982a556 Merge pull request '외부커넥션관리' (#51) from lhj into dev
Reviewed-on: http://39.117.244.52:3000/kjs/ERP-node/pulls/51
2025-09-24 10:05:45 +09:00
leeheejin bc6e6056c1 외부커넥션관리 2025-09-24 10:04:25 +09:00
kjs a757034d86 엔티티타입 표시방식 변경 2025-09-23 17:43:24 +09:00
kjs 28109eb63b fix: 엔티티 컬럼 조인 테이블 정보 자동 가져오기 기능 추가
- loadEntityDisplayConfig에서 joinTable이 비어있을 때 Entity 조인 API로 조인 테이블 정보 자동 조회
- 조인 테이블 정보를 찾으면 entityDisplayConfig에 자동 업데이트
- 상세한 로깅으로 조인 테이블 정보 조회 과정 추적 가능
2025-09-23 17:11:07 +09:00
kjs 4c5e0330ef fix: TableListConfigPanel API 호출 수정 및 엔티티 컬럼 참조 테이블 로깅 추가
- fetch('/api/tables') 직접 호출을 tableTypeApi.getTables()로 변경하여 올바른 포트 사용
- 엔티티 컬럼 감지 시 reference_table/referenceTable 필드 로깅 추가
- joinTable 설정 시 두 필드 모두 확인하도록 수정
2025-09-23 17:08:52 +09:00
kjs ad7f350f00 fix: API 클라이언트 설정 원복 및 빈 테이블명 API 호출 방지
- API 클라이언트를 원래 포트 8080으로 되돌림
- loadEntityDisplayConfig에서 sourceTable/joinTable이 비어있을 때 API 호출 방지
- 불필요한 백엔드 서버 중지
2025-09-23 17:06:23 +09:00
kjs f01be49f6a fix: TableListConfigPanel에서 컬럼 검색 필드명 수정
- tc.column_name → tc.columnName으로 수정
- tableColumns 구조에 맞게 컬럼 검색 로직 수정
- 디버깅 로그 개선
2025-09-23 16:59:12 +09:00
kjs 9d346a3d3a fix: 엔티티 컬럼 표시 설정 문제 해결
- TableListComponent에서 엔티티 컬럼 라벨을 기준 테이블 라벨로 표시
- TableListConfigPanel에서 input_type 필드로 엔티티 컬럼 감지
- ScreenDesigner에서 컬럼 정보 로드 시 input_type 필드 포함
- UnifiedColumnInfo 타입에 input_type 필드 추가
- 엔티티 컬럼 감지 로직에 디버깅 로그 추가

이제 화면 편집기에서 엔티티 컬럼의 표시 컬럼 설정이 정상적으로 보여야 함
2025-09-23 16:51:12 +09:00
kjs de6c7a8008 feat: 엔티티 타입 컬럼 표시 설정을 화면 편집기로 이동
- 테이블 타입 관리에서 엔티티 타입의 표시 컬럼 설정 완전 제거
- 컬럼 설정 패널에서 엔티티 타입일 때 표시 컬럼 조합 선택 기능 추가
- 기본 테이블과 조인 테이블의 컬럼을 자유롭게 조합 가능
- 구분자 설정 및 실시간 미리보기 기능 포함
- 별도 모달 방식 제거하고 기존 컬럼 설정 패널에 통합
2025-09-23 16:23:36 +09:00
hjlee 51a1d4572c Merge pull request 'lhj' (#50) from lhj into dev
Reviewed-on: http://39.117.244.52:3000/kjs/ERP-node/pulls/50
2025-09-23 16:07:58 +09:00
leeheejin affb6899cc 수정할때 비밀번호 틀리면 연결안되게 2025-09-23 16:05:30 +09:00
kjs 4aefb5be6a 엔티티 타입 다중 표시 컬럼 기능 구현
Frontend:
- EntityTypeConfig 인터페이스에 displayColumns 배열 추가
- EntityTypeConfigPanel에서 여러 표시 컬럼 선택 UI 구현
- 구분자 설정 기능 추가
- 하위 호환성을 위한 displayColumn 유지

Backend:
- EntityJoinConfig에 displayColumns 배열 지원
- 화면별 엔티티 설정을 전달받는 API 확장
- CONCAT을 사용한 다중 컬럼 표시 SQL 생성
- 기존 단일 컬럼과의 호환성 유지

이제 화면마다 다른 표시 컬럼 조합을 설정할 수 있음
예: 한 화면에서는 '이름'만, 다른 화면에서는 '이름 - 부서명' 표시
2025-09-23 15:58:54 +09:00
kjs d9270e6307 Merge pull request 'feature/screen-management' (#49) from feature/screen-management into main
Reviewed-on: http://39.117.244.52:3000/kjs/ERP-node/pulls/49
2025-09-23 15:38:41 +09:00